Lets compare vitamin content per 1 pound of Syrups, corn, light vs Syrups, corn, high-fructose:
Syrups, corn, light have more Vitamin B1 than Syrups, corn, high-fructose.
While Syrups, corn, high-fructose contain more Vitamin B2 than Syrups, corn, light.
Both Syrups, corn, light as well as Syrups, corn, high-fructose have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B6, Vitamin B9, Vitamin B12, Vitamin C, Vitamin D, Vitamin E and Vitamin K in 1 lb.
Comparing minerals per 1 pound for Syrups, corn, light vs Syrups, corn, high-fructose:
Syrups, corn, light have more Calcium, 31 times more Sodium and 22 times more Zinc than Syrups, corn, high-fructose.
While Syrups, corn, high-fructose contain more Copper and more Manganese than Syrups, corn, light.
Both Syrups, corn, light and Syrups, corn, high-fructose have similar amounts of Selenium per 1 lb.
Both Syrups, corn, light as well as Syrups, corn, high-fructose have insufficient amounts of Iron, Magnesium, Phosphorus and Potassium in 1 lb.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 1 pound:
Both Syrups, corn, light and Syrups, corn, high-fructose have similar amounts of macro-nutrients per 1 lb
Both Syrups, corn, light and Syrups, corn, high-fructose have similar amounts of Energy, Carbohydrate and Sugars per 1 lb.
Both Syrups, corn, light as well as Syrups, corn, high-fructose have insufficient amounts of Fat, Omega 3, Omega 6, Cholesterol, Glucose, Sucrose, Fiber and Protein in 1 lb.
